The land of Roar

"When Arthur and Rose were little, they were heroes in theLand of Roar, an imaginary world that they found by climbing through the folding bed in their grandad's attic. Roar was filled with things they loved--dragons, mermaids, ninja wizards and adventure--as well as things that scared them (including a very creepy scarecrow). Now the twins are eleven, Roar is just a memory. But when they help Grandad clean out the attic, Arthur is horrified as Grandad is pulled into the folding bed and vanishes. Is he playing a joke? Or is Roar--real?"--OCLC.
